On March 9, the Boards of County Commissioners in Chelan, Douglas and Okanogan counties finalized an agreement combining the Okanogan County Horticultural Pest & Disease Board with the joint Chelan-Douglas Horticultural Pest & Disease Board. The new board is named the Tri-County Horticultural Pest & Disease Board.

The public is invited to pick up a free KN95 mask at one of several distribution spots around Chelan and Douglas counties. Made available by the Chelan County Department of Emergency Management, the KN95 respiratory masks feature multi-layer protection against fine particulate, including particulate related to smoke from wildfires.
